Recipe for Codfish Scaloppine with Sweet Peppers and Marjoram

Yield:
4
Ingredients:
Amount Ingredient
8 tbl Virgin olive oil
1 med Onion chopped 1/4" dice
2 lrg Red bell peppers
2 lrg Yellow peppers
2 lrg Green peppers
1 tsp Dried marjoram leaves
1 lb Fresh cod fillet from thickest
1 prt fish
4 oz All-purpose flour
Salt to taste
Freshly-ground black pepper to taste
1 cup Dry white wine
Instructions:
Instructions: In a 12-inch skillet, heat 4 tablespoons olive oil until smoking. Remove ribs, seeds, and stem from all peppers and chop into 1/2-inch dice. Saute onion in smoking oil until wilted. Add peppers and dried marjoram and cook until softened yet still holding individual shape (about 6 to 7 minutes). Remove from heat and set aside.

Heat 4 tablespoons virgin olive oil in 12-inch nonstick skillet over moderate heat. Slice codfish into 8 medallions approximately 1/2-inch thick, season with salt and pepper and dredge in flour. Place in nonstick skillet and saute until golden brown on one side. Without turning fish, add wine and cooked pepper mixture and bring to a boil. Simmer 3 minutes, turn fish over, and simmer for 2 minutes more. Add fresh marjoram leaves, mix and remove fish from sauce to four individual plates. Spoon sauce over each fillet and serve.

This recipe yields 4 servings.
